(to vegan or not to vegan)

I think I'm going to write a book called, "I Would Be A Vegan If It Weren't For Chick-fil-A."

Or I might have to call it something else because of some trademark thing, like, "I Would Be A Vegan If It Weren't For That Chicken Place That Is Not Open On Sundays."

Everyone would understand.

Really, I would. I like eating vegan. It feels good, literally, to eat so healthily, so many fruits and veggies and whole grains. I love cooking that way, it takes no time at all, and no heavy meat to worry about.

Except.

Except that Chick-fil-A is really good. The sweet tea is divine (yes, I could probably still be vegan with that, I know) but it's the nuggets and waffle fries that get me every time. I get cravings, I daydream, I whip up excuses to get gas out of my way to drive-through.

But I promise, the rest of the time, I am whipping up barley casseroles and black bean burgers to beat the band. And I enjoy those meals very much. To be honest, I think too much.

Virtuous eating.

[Which, by the way is very different than "virtual" eating when you are imagining that you are eating something and you really are not. Tried that too. Not satisfying.]

Yes, I feel very virtuous eating vegan, very clean, very above-the-fray. Please understand, I am NOT making fun of vegans. I am saying I have so much respect for those of you who have such wonderful discipline.

Chick-fil-A always gets in the way!

Really, I have no other issues with any other restaurant, and I don't eat fast food. (I realize that many of you consider CFA fast food, but you are wrong. It is food fast. That's different.)

And if I were super-honest, I would say that I actually become a little prideful, thus the "above-the-fray" feeling when the truth is that it is a choice and not everybody has to make it to be a good person, a godly person, who likes animals.

So it may be a good thing that God keeps me humble with my nugget cravings. It is probably also a blessing to my children that they know about one meal per week will have waffle fries. (They do not enjoy vegan so much.)

So, my confession. Nothing should make me feel like I'm better than anyone else. Not even tofu.

I Corinthians 10:31 So, whether you eat or drink, or whatever you do, do all to the glory of God.
